30Si(p,α)27Al reaction at 40.75 MeV

Description
Differential cross sections have been measured for the 30Si(p, α)27Al reaction at an incident energy of 40.75 MeV. The experimental (p,α) relative cross sections are well reproduced by distorted wave direct pickup calculations with a triton cluster form factor and current shell model wave functions
